If you want info, here it is. These are leaked copies of the training materials that Verizon is sending to "indirect" retailers like BestBuy.

For those who have a feature phone, but are thinking they'll eventually want to upgrade to have unlimited data, they need to do so by July 7th. This is a quote from the training material in the above link. Notice the part I bolded:

Existing customer KEEP their $29.99 unlimited data plan

If an existing customer upgrades from a feature phone to a smart phone after 7/7/11, they will NOT be able to add on the unlimited data package. They must choose from the new data plans.

Anyone who sets up new service with unlimited data, upgrades from a feature phone to a smart phone with unlimited data, or customer currently on the $29.99 before July, 7, 2011 will be grandfathered in.

These changes also apply to employee plans as well (personal accounts w/work discounts applied)

I never came close to using 2GB while I had an android phone; my average was 400-500 mb per month.

However, I just switched to an iPhone which has the Netflix app, so I can now watch movies in my instant queue wherever I am. I still have 6 days to go till the end of this billing cycle and I have used 2.3 GB.

Thank goodness I am grandfathered into the unlimited plan :rotfl:

I know Verizon still has the right to increase the cost of the unlimited plan but AT&T hasn't done that to their grandfathered customers yet (that I'm aware of) so I'm not going to worry about that until I have to.
